ubuntu 查看端口被占用并处理】的更多相关文章

当启动程序出现端口号被占用的情况,需要查看端口使用情况,使用netstat命令,下面是常用的几个查看端口情况的命令:查看所有的服务端口(ESTABLISHED netstat -a查看所有的服务端口,显示pid号(LISTEN,ESTABLISHED)     netstat -ap 查看某一(**)端口,则可以结合grep命令: netstat -ap | grep ** 如查看**端口,也可以在终端中输入: lsof -i:** 若要停止使用这个端口的程序,使用kill +对应的pid ki…
做网络的同学,估计会经常用到这个功能,这里就做一个记录吧. 首先查看特定端口是占用了: sudo netstat -nplt 其次要删除特定端口并查看: kill -9 pid_num sudo netstat -nplt 这里顺便熟悉一下netstat的参数: -a (all)显示所有选项,默认不显示LISTEN相关-t (tcp)仅显示tcp相关选项-u (udp)仅显示udp相关选项-n 拒绝显示别名,能显示数字的全部转化成数字.-l 仅列出有在 Listen (监听) 的服務状态 -p…
windows上用netstat命令查看某个端口是否占用,被哪个进程所占用 1.查看端口的占用情况,获取进程的PID 命令: netstat -ano | findstr "<端口号>" 比如:查看6924端口号的占用情况 C:\Windows\my_server>netstat -ano | findstr "5924" TCP 0.0.0.0:5924 0.0.0.0:0 LISTENING 1448 2.查找PID对应的进程 命令: task…
1. tomcat有安装版和压缩版 安装版的没有关闭命令 压缩版的命令如下: tomcat关闭:catalina stop/shutdown 开启:catalina start   2. 在tomcat->webpps->新建目录(最好英文名)->把网页内容复制到文件夹里->再通过浏览器访问:http://localhhost:80/a.html   3. 如何查看端口被占用???   进入cmd,netstat -aon|findstr 80,80表示要查看的端口号. 0.0.0…
linux 查看端口被占用 1.lsof  -i : 端口号 用于查看某一端口的占用情况,比如查看8080端口使用情况,lsof  -i:8080 如果执行 lsof  -i:8080 系统提示 : -bash: lsof: 未找到命令,则要安装lsof   使用 yum install lsof   如下图:安装完成再执行就可以看到被8080占用的情况 lsof -i  lsof 输出信息意义: COMMAND:进程名的 PID: 进程标识符 USER:进程所有者 FD:文件描述符 应用程序通…
转载地址: https://www.linuxidc.com/Linux/2016-01/127345.htm Ubuntu查看端口使用情况,使用netstat命令: 查看已经连接的服务端口(ESTABLISHED) netstat -a 查看所有的服务端口(LISTEN,ESTABLISHED) netstat -ap 查看指定端口,可以结合grep命令: netstat -ap | grep 8080 也可以使用lsof命令: lsof -i:8888 若要关闭使用这个端口的程序,使用kil…
目录 1 lsof查看端口的占用情况 1.1 命令使用示例 1.2 查看某一端口的占用情况 1.3 杀死某个端口的所有进程 2 netstat查看端口占用情况 2.1 命令使用示例 2.2 查看占用某个端口的进程 2.3 杀死某个端口的占用进程 1 lsof查看端口的占用情况 1.1 命令使用示例 # 命令为 lsof -i [root@onepiece ~]# lsof -i # 将会显示 命令 + 进程ID + 进程所属用户, 以及监听的协议.状态等信息 COMMAND PID USER F…
一   根据端口号 查找对应的服务 比如我们查查找端口号8189对应的服务是哪个 1  先根据端口号查找对应对的pid(进程id)为23367 netstat -anp  | grep 8189       状态为LISTEN 正在监听(已占用) 2 根据进程id查找对应的服务 ps -ef |grep  23367 二  查看进程及其占用的端口号 1 netstat -anp | grep  进程名   获得进程id 23367 2 根据进程id  查看端口号 netstat -anp  |…
本文摘写自: 百度经验 https://www.cnblogs.com/ieayoio/p/5757198.html 一.windows:开始---->运行---->cmd,或者是window+R组合键,调出命令窗口 1.输入命令:netstat -ano,列出所有端口的情况.在列表中我们观察被占用的端口,比如是49157,首先找到它. 2.查看被占用端口对应的PID,输入命令:netstat -aon|findstr "49157",回车,记下最后一位数字,即PID,这里…
查看某端口的占用情况: lsof -i:<端口号> 例如:lsof -i:8080 netstat -apn|grep <端口号> 例如: netstat -apn | grep 8080 找到进程号以后,再使用以下命令查看详细信息: ps -aux|grep <进程号> 知道进程号后, kill <pid> 可以杀死进程 或者 killall <进程名>    (这个先使用lsof -i:8080  或者 lsof -i 来确定进程名) 查看进…